Job Summary

  • The role provides strategic leadership for engineering and maintenance operations across the WashU Medicine campus and its satellite locations.
  • The position is responsible for ensuring the reliability, safety, and resilience of mission-critical infrastructure while overseeing RFP development and service contract administration.
  • WashU offers competitive benefits including up to 22 days of vacation, health insurance packages, and tuition coverage for employees and their families.

Key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ent combination of education and experience
  • 10 years of relevant experience at an institution of similar size and complexity
  • Class E (MO) or Class D (IL) driver's license with good driving record
  • Preferred: Master of Business Administration (MBA)
  • Preferred: Professional Engineer (PE) certification
